5-Day Low Budget Itinerary in Chennai, St Thomas Mount Church, Chennai

Monday, November 20: Arrival in Chennai

Morning: Upon arrival in Chennai, settle into your hotel and get acquainted with the city. Visit Marina Beach, the second-longest urban beach in the world, and enjoy a leisurely stroll while taking in the beautiful views of the Bay of Bengal.

Afternoon: Explore the Government Museum, which houses a diverse collection of art, archaeological artifacts, and natural history exhibits. Get a glimpse into the rich history and culture of Chennai.

Evening: Indulge in some street shopping at T Nagar, a bustling neighborhood known for its vibrant markets. Bargain for traditional clothing, accessories, and souvenirs at affordable prices.

  • Marina Beach: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Government Museum: INR 15 (approx. $0.20), 2-3 hours
  • T Nagar Street Shopping: Varied costs, 2-3 hours
Tuesday, November 21: St Thomas Mount Church

Morning: Visit the iconic St Thomas Mount Church, an important religious site and historical landmark. Explore the church premises and enjoy the serene atmosphere atop the mount.

Afternoon: Head to the nearby Little Mount Shrine, another significant Christian pilgrimage site associated with St. Thomas the Apostle. Admire the beautiful architecture and learn about its historical significance.

Evening: Take a leisurely stroll along the peaceful Adyar River and enjoy the scenic beauty. You can also visit Theosophical Society Adyar, a tranquil oasis that promotes spiritual and philosophical practices.

  • St Thomas Mount Church: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Little Mount Shrine: Free, 1-2 hours
  • Adyar River Walk and Theosophical Society Adyar: Free, 2-3 hours
Wednesday, November 22: Explore Chennai's Cultural Heritage

Morning: Visit the Kapaleeshwarar Temple in Mylapore, a stunning Dravidian-style temple dedicated to Lord Shiva. Marvel at the intricate architecture and immerse yourself in the spiritual ambiance. (Note: This temple visit is optional, as per the special request)

Afternoon: Explore the Fort St. George complex, which houses the St. Mary's Church, Fort Museum, and the historic Wellesley House. Dive into Chennai's colonial past and learn about its role in Indian history.

Evening: Experience the lively atmosphere of Pondy Bazaar, a popular shopping district known for its affordable clothing, accessories, and street food. Enjoy some delicious local snacks as you browse through the bustling markets.

  • Kapaleeshwarar Temple (optional): Free, 1-2 hours
  • Fort St. George: INR 10 (approx. $0.13), 2-3 hours
  • Pondy Bazaar: Varied costs, 2-3 hours
Thursday, November 23: Day Trip to Mahabalipuram

Morning: Take a day trip to Mahabalipuram, a UNESCO World Heritage Site renowned for its ancient temples and stone sculptures. Explore famous attractions like the Shore Temple and the Arjuna's Penance, which depict scenes from Hindu mythology.

Afternoon: Visit The Five Rathas, monolithic rock-cut temples showcasing distinctive architectural styles. Marvel at the intricate carvings and craftsmanship.

Evening: Enjoy the Sunset at Mahabalipuram Beach and relax by the scenic coastline before heading back to Chennai.

  • Transportation: Bus or Shared Cab - Costs vary
  • Mahabalipuram Entrance Fee: INR 50 (approx. $0.70)
  • Explore monuments and temples in Mahabalipuram: Free, time varies
Friday, November 24: Local Experiences and Farewell

Morning: Visit the vibrant Kalakshetra Foundation, dedicated to the promotion of Indian art and culture. Enjoy cultural performances, explore the art galleries, and witness traditional crafts being practiced.

Afternoon: Wind down your trip with a visit to Elliot's Beach, also known as Besant Nagar Beach. Indulge in some street food, fly kites, or simply relax by the sea.

Evening: Bid farewell to Chennai with a traditional South Indian meal at a local eatery. Enjoy authentic flavors and savor the last moments of your trip.

  • Kalakshetra Foundation: INR 100 (approx. $1.35), 2-3 hours
  • Elliot's Beach: Free, time varies
  • Traditional South Indian meal: Costs vary

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, consider exploring the beautiful Broken Bridge along the Adyar River, which offers stunning views during sunrise and sunset. Additionally, locals love visiting Cholamandal Artists' Village, an artists' commune showcasing contemporary Indian art. The village also has art galleries and handicraft shops where you can appreciate and purchase unique artworks.
